Added DiffLines:


While helping Keoni practice for a boat race at the beach, Lilo sees an ominous shark fin heading straight for his boat. He jumps out as the fin effortlessly shreds the boat in half. Lilo goes back home and demonstrates for Jumba what happened at the beach, and Jumba recognizes the shark as experiment 602, designed to slice ships in half and sink entire fleets. Realizing that Keoni's boat race is in jeopardy, Lilo makes a plan to capture 602.

Gantu, tracking 602, rents a boat with Reuben and sets out on the open sea. However, 602 slices his ship in half and sinks him. Lilo and Stitch have no better luck using Jumba's high-tech water buggy, and they too have their ship sliced in half.[[note]]Stitch would usually sink like a rock, but the duo are wearing Jumba's high-tech life vests.[[/note]] Jumba and Pleakley use a rowboat to save Lilo and Stitch, but the boat is once again destroyed by 602.

As the four slowly drift out to sea, they see a passing cruise ship. Stitch climbs aboard the ship to lower the anchor into the water, hoisting everyone up onto the deck. Lilo and Stitch look for the captain in order to find a way off the ship and bask to chasing 602. However, an overly-cheerful, slightly off-putting cruise director finds them and sends them to the ship's daycare. They try to escape but are caught once again. The cruise director discovers that they (along with Jumba and Pleakley) are stowaways and send everyone to the brig. The captain announces that they will make a stop at Kauai island, but since that is where 602 is, the cruise ship is sure to be sliced in half.

Jumba reveals that he had been making a diving suit for Stitch while Lilo and Stitch were stuck in daycare, and hidden it in a nearby lifeboat. But first thing's first, they need to bust out of the brig. Literally bust out. As in, Stitch punches a giant hole in the wall and they all climb through. Stitch puts on the diving suit and jumps in the water to battle 602. Everyone else disguises as tourists and try to find the captain. They open the door to the bridge but accidentally knock the captain out of the window and into the water in the process.[[note]]The captain had dropped his monocle and bent down to get it, so Pleakley assumed no one was on the bridge and slammed open the door, knocking him into the water.[[/note]] With no captain to steer the ship, Jumba and Pleakley fight over who should man the controls until the steering wheel breaks in half.

Stitch confronts 602 underwater nearby the ship. After a scuffle, Stitch climbs back on the ship and rips out its anchor, using it to wrap around 602, containing it successfully. The ship softly runs aground on a sand bar as Lilo jokingly comments that she found a new boat for Keoni's competition. Everyone disembarks the cruise ship and celebrates at a local Japanese restaurant. 602 (now named Sinker) has found his one true place as a hibachi chef -- cutting things to his heart's content.
